Watch Your Words.
There are those who speak rashly, like the piercing of a sword, but the tongue of the wise
brings healing. -Proverbs 12:18
Our lives have been greatly impacted by the words that have been spoken to us. Likewise,our words impact the lives of those around us--for better or for worse. That's a sobering thought.
Many people have been crippled with insecurity because their parents spoke words of judgement, criticism, and failure to them. These wounded people can be healed by receiving God's unconditional love, but it takes time to overcome the wrong image they have of themselves.
That's why it is important to use our words for blessing, healing, and building up instead of for cursing, wounding, and tearing down.
If you've been wounded by words, be quick to receive God's unconditional love. Let Him heal any unhealthy and false images you may have of yourself. If you have been fortunate enough to escape such damage, determine that your words will bring blessing and healing to others.
